Output 68f021833eb00a1f29c7cfcfefa5d625bddb41e5279d3c0aaa1d87953a2b0a89:1

value
64362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b2735cac9495cc8d929bd46dd2a332b625678b OP_EQUAL
address
3NMgQs7L7zKEt73CNZs8TEBfhNw83SDGRA
transaction
68f021833eb00a1f29c7cfcfefa5d625bddb41e5279d3c0aaa1d87953a2b0a89
confirmations
301865
spent
true